Veterinary Neurology Terms
Term | Definition |
---|---|
Neuron | Single nerve cell w/ a cell body, axon, dendrite. |
Afferent (sensory) Neuron | Neurons that conduct impulses from body to brain and spinal cord. |
Efferent (motor) Neuron | Motor neurons that convey impulses from brain and spinal cord to muscles and glands. |
Reflex | Involuntary response to stimuli. |
Encecphal/o | Combining form for brain |
Myel/o | Combining form for spinal cord. |
Epidural | Injecting local anesthesia agent into epidural space or spinal canal->numbs. |
Ataxia | Failure of muscular coordination; irregularity of muscular reaction. |
Hematoma | Localized collection of extravasculated blood; usually clotted (bruise). |
IVDD | Intervertebral disc disease-- Pain and neurologic defects, the paralysis-- displacement of part or all nucleus of intervertebral discs. |
Analgesia | Insensibility to pain. |
Anesthesia | Loss of feeling in part or all of body. |
Laminectomy | Procedure in which a portion of the vertebral arch is removed to relieve signs caused by IVDD. |
